Overview
We are seeking a highly skilled Construction Project Manager with experience in pharmaceutical or GMP-regulated environments to lead the planning, execution, and delivery of construction projects within our facilities. The successful candidate will ensure that all projects meet regulatory standards, are completed on time and within budget, and support the operational needs of pharmaceutical manufacturing and research.
Responsibilities
* Ensure compliance with GMP, and other relevant regulatory standards.
* Collaborate with cross-functional teams including Quality, Engineering, and Operations.
* Develop and manage project budgets, schedules, and risk assessments.
* Oversee contractor performance, ensuring adherence to safety and quality standards.
* Coordinate commissioning and qualification activities.
* Maintain accurate documentation and reporting throughout the project lifecycle.
* Lead project meetings and communicate progress to stakeholders and senior leadership.
* Ensure projects are effectively resourced and manage relationships with a wide range of groups.
* Own the permit process for Mitie projects, working with technical supervisors where required to ensure permits are in place and correctly closed.
Qualifications / Skills
* Experience as a Project Manager within the pharmaceutical or GMP-regulated field leading construction projects including HVAC, process utilities, and automation systems.
* Proficient in project management tools with excellent computer skills.
* Strong leadership, communication, and stakeholder management skills.
* High focus on service quality and performance; professional representation of Mitie with integrity and honesty.
* Proactive planning and regular alignment with plans/programmes as the project progresses.
* Strong sense of achievement; ability to drive projects forward and overcome barriers.
* Understanding of risk management and Health, Safety and Environment (HSE).
